Description
Lustrous and very slightly irridescent cuprite crystals (to 6 mm), intergrown on a gossanous matrix. The crystals are predominantly octahedral, but with cube and dodecahedron forms also present, and some weak and localised development of skeletal growth. A few incomplete tabular crystals of tan-coloured wulfenite are associated.
The specimen is from the collection of the Reverend A.E. Gardner which was purchased by the Australian Bureau of Mineral Resources (now Geoscience Australia) in 1974. There is no record of earlier provenance or location in the mine.
